Jun. 04, 2026 11:30 a.m. - 1:00 p.m.
Jim Szczesniak, A.A.E. Director of Aviation for the Houston Airport System (HAS). Jim has more than two decades of management experience in both the public and private sector. He is responsible for the overall management of the Houston Airport System’s three aviation facilities: George Bush Intercontinental Airport (IAH), William P. Hobby Airport (HOU) and Ellington Airport (EFD). Previously, Mr. Szczesniak served as the Airport Director for the Ted Stevens Anchorage International Airport (ANC). ANC is the world’s fourth busiest air cargo airport and gateway to Alaska. Jim also spent a decade at the Chicago Department of Aviation. Jim started in airport operations at O’Hare International Airport, became Director of Airport Planning and ultimately Deputy Commissioner of Aviation at O’Hare and Midway International Airport. Mr. Szczesniak holds a MBA from the University of Chicago and a Bachelor’s in Aviation Management from Southern Illinois University. Jim is a licensed commercial pilot and aircraft mechanic. Jim is an Accredited Airport Executive by the American Association of Airport Executives. |

Jul. 16, 2026 11:30 a.m. - 1:00 p.m.
We look forward to hearing the annual Kinder Houston Area Survey - The economy, the environment, and the Importance of Social Connection. Our speaker will present the 45th edition of the survey with a new component and several surprises. The data should interest anyone who lives or works in Houston and surrounding areas, wonders how Houstonians are doing in a changing economy, and those who have following this survey for so many years. Ruth N. Lopez Turley, Director, Kinder Institute Professor Turley is the director of the Kinder Institute for Urban Research at Rice University. Prior to her current right, she directed the institute's Houston Education Research Consortium during which time she raised over $30 million so school districts would not have to pay for research. She also founded the National Network of Education Research-Practice Partnerships, which connects and supports over 70 partnerships between research institutions and education agencies throughout the country. She served on the National Board for Education Sciences which advised and approved priorities for the research arm of the U.S. Department of Education.

Jul. 23, 2026 11:30 a.m. - 1:00 p.m.
Flooding has certainly impacted Houston and understanding the Harris County flood maps and the current risks impact us all whether it is our homes, offices, commuting, or general stress level when we hear the severe weather reports. Hear directly from the executive director of Harris County Flood Control District.
The New Map of Flood Danger
Dr. Christina “Tina” Petersen, Ph.D., P.E., Executive Director, Harris County Flood Control District
Dr. Christina “Tina” Petersen, Ph.D., P.E., is the Executive Director for the Harris County Flood Control District in Harris County, Texas, serving the greater Houston region. She has served in this role since January 2022, when she was unanimously appointed to the position by Harris County Commissioners Court.
Under Dr. Petersen’s direction, the Flood Control District carries out its mission to plan, implement and maintain projects that reduce the risk of flooding, ultimately improving the quality of life for Harris County residents.
Dr. Petersen also represents Harris County on the board of directors for the Gulf Coast Protection District, the Texas Water Conservation Association, as well as the executive committees of the National Association of Flood and Stormwater Management Agencies and the San Jacinto Regional Flood Planning Group. |
